ORCL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2022 in Review
2,191 of the 5,936 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Oracle (ORCL) for Q2 2022, worth a combined $78.3B — down 15% from $92.5B a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 158 funds closed out of ORCL and 111 opened new positions — a net loss of 47 holders — while 899 trimmed existing stakes and 811 added.
The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$724M. The largest seller was Loomis, Sayles & Company, cutting an estimated $422M.
